I don't think that the argument that there is no "standard" way to do it means that no solution exists.
As I mentioned in the OP, java does this with a calendar object that provides a means to hide the idiosyncrocies of handling dates while also providing options to the developer of how they want to manipulate the dates.http://docs.oracle.com/javase/7/docs/api/java/util/GregorianCalendar.html#add(int,%20int). The roll() function seems to do exactly what I want, and I what I expected adding 1 month to the date/time record would have done.

Okay attached is a quick and dirty solution. It will add the number of days that are in the current month, so the day stays the same and the month increments by one. If there is a rollover where January 30th, just add enough to land on the last day of the month in February. I think that is what you meant by truncate. It doesn't currently detect leap year but the subVI could be modified to handle that.

Also note that Hoovah's VI doesn't take into account daylight savings time, so if you are counting on the time, it could be off an hour if you cross a time change in that month period.

Oh thanks for mentioning that. OP really was just talking about dates so I focused on that.
If you are taking a time and adding a month, you could end up with some odd results. Adding a month to 03:00 January 28th, makes 03:00 February 28th, but then adding a month to 02:00 January 29th would make 02:00 February 29th, which is an odd case where a time can go backwards, for a month to a later date.

Here was my take on the problem.
Worked on it during lunch without checking the thread for updates.
My version should maintain the time between standard/savings and deals with shorter months. You can use a value of -1 for the DST field in a date/time rec to ignore DST.
One case not handled is leap year.
